Output f803bdb6aa3bd2bc340bcfedd5c958b91f32e96e2d6bdb2e7a67c0d343e1e6a6:3

value
138000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7ca5ca130776e9cea7f39c9b33f46de02b2284c OP_EQUALVERIFY OP_CHECKSIG
address
1LfzhbEmWVWG6imfP1Xd4vbg4urytDCmji
transaction
f803bdb6aa3bd2bc340bcfedd5c958b91f32e96e2d6bdb2e7a67c0d343e1e6a6
confirmations
589539
spent
true